ประเภทหนัง
ตัวอย่างหนัง Ethereum: Is it possible for someone to verify that a wallet is theirs wallet, without providing their private key?
Verifying Wallet Ownership Without Providing the Private Key
In the digital age, cryptocurrency transactions are becoming increasingly complex and verifying wallet ownership can be a daunting task. One question that has piqued the curiosity of enthusiasts and security experts alike is, “Is it possible to verify that a wallet belongs to its owner without providing the private key?” The answer is not a simple yes or no, but rather a nuanced exploration of cryptographic techniques.
What Makes a Wallet Secure?
A wallet’s security relies on its ability to be encrypted and protected from unauthorized access. One aspect of this practice is the use of passwords, PINs, or other authentication mechanisms that prevent others from accessing the private keys associated with a wallet. However, these measures are not foolproof, as an attacker could potentially guess or brute-force the password.
Private Key Management
To verify ownership without providing the private key, we need to dive into the world of private key management. A private key is a unique string that serves as a digital signature for every transaction on a blockchain network. It is essentially a cryptographic fingerprint that universalizes transactions and allows for secure verification.
There are several techniques for effectively managing private keys:
- Hardware Wallets: Hardware wallets, such as Trezor or Ledger, store the private key offline, making it virtually impossible for an attacker to access it without the physical device.
- Seed Phrases: Some wallets use seed phrases, which contain a series of words that serve as a backup in case of hardware loss or damage. These phrases are used to restore the wallet and regain ownership.
- Paper Wallets: Paper wallets provide a secure way to store private keys on paper, using QR codes or other formats to link the wallet to its corresponding seed phrase.
Ownership Verification Without a Private Key
While it is theoretically possible to verify wallet ownership by checking blockchain history or identifying patterns in account behavior, these methods have inherent limitations:
- Blockchain History: Checking the blockchain can reveal activity on the account, which does not necessarily indicate that the owner is the original holder.
- Behavioral Patterns: Analyzing transaction patterns can help identify suspicious activity, but it does not guarantee the identity of the owner without additional context.
Brute-Force Attacks
Unfortunately, brute-force attacks still pose a viable threat to wallet security. An attacker could attempt to guess or decrypt the private key using specialized software or services. These types of attacks typically require significant computing power and can be launched with minimal investment.
Bottom Line
Verifying wallet ownership without providing the private key remains an elusive goal in today’s digital landscape. While some wallets, such as those used by established organizations (e.g., Ethereum), offer more robust security features, these solutions are not foolproof.
To minimize risk and ensure the integrity of your crypto holdings:
- Use a reputable wallet provider: Choose a well-established wallet that prioritizes security and follows best practices for private key management.
- Keep your wallet offline: Hardware or paper wallets can help protect against unauthorized access.
- Be careful with seed phrases: Make sure you understand how to recover property in the event of loss or damage to property.
While caution is essential when handling cryptocurrencies, using secure practices and tools can significantly reduce the risk of a wallet compromise.